Step 1: Tomatoes ... Add the tomatoes, garlic, oregano, and olive oil to a non-stick saute pan; and bring to medium heat. Saute, for 5-7 minutes, just until the tomatoes begin to soften and pop; stirring often. Season with a little salt and pepper to taste. Transfer to the counter off the heat to cool.
Step 2: Puree ... Also, remove the oregano stems and peels off the garlic. Add everything to a food processor (once cooled), including any juices; and, add the butter and basil. Puree until smooth; season with additional salt and pepper if necessary.
Step 3: Butter Log ... Add the butter to a piece of plastic; then, wrap and roll into a log. Twist the ends tight; and, refrigerate until firm; or freeze.
Step 4: Serve and ENJOY! ... As mentioned, this is great 'condiment,' as a spread on a toasted baguette; perfect on cooked vegetables, seafood, chicken, steak, or pork. It is delicious with so many things; and, very easy to make.
